Seeking Instaward funding to get started

StellarProof is applying for an Instaward grant to build zero-knowledge verification on Stellar testnet. Once funded, a user will be able to verify once with a licensed provider, receive a credential sealed to their wallet, and prove age, jurisdiction, document validity and non-revocation to an anchor that verifies the proof on chain without any party seeing the underlying document.

The grant will fund the circuit, three Soroban contracts, an issuer service integrated with a licensed KYC provider, the holder wallet, the anchor SDK, and a demo anchor exercising the whole flow end to end, along with a full test suite covering unit, integration, and end-to-end checks against the deployed contracts.

After Instaward phase — the path to mainnet

1.Multi-party trusted setup ceremony
Run the circuit-specific phase-2 ceremony with independent, publicly named external contributors and published contribution hashes. This is a blocking requirement before mainnet.
2.External security audit
Independent review of the ZK circuit and the Soroban contracts.
3.Pilot integrations
Live pilots with South American anchors on testnet — real users, real KYC provider verifications, real drop-off numbers to replace the industry estimates used elsewhere in this documentation.
4.Mainnet launch
Production deployment, multi-issuer federation so anchors are not dependent on a single issuer, and a scalable revocation witness service.
